Compare And Contrast Greece And Persia
Two dominant civilizations of the Ancient World; Greece and Persia; were similar in multiple ways.
Both civilizations were heavily invested in militaristic assets which including military forces over sea
and land. As a result of being highly invested in their military assets, both civilizations used military
force to gain power. However, the two civilizations differed in the manner in which they were
governed. For example, Ancient Persia was united under a single ruler that was known as a king.
Ancient Greece on the other hand, was governed by military officials, aristocrats, and occasionally
tyrants. In return the manner in which each civilization was controlled by their ruler, molded how each
civilization would become and created differentiations

The Salem witchcraft trials took place in colonial Massachusetts between February 1692 and May
1693. The news of witches began to spread in Salem when a group of young girls gathered together in
the kitchen of the Reverend Samuel Parris with his Indian slave named Tituba to experiment with
witchcraft. After these young girls began to portray unusual behavior the village doctor came to the
scene and diagnosed the girls to be possessed by the devil. The news of the presence of witches spread
throughout Salem like a craze and lead to a series of accusations and turmoil.
The Salem witchcraft trials were a collection of trials, hearings, accusations, imprisonments, and
executions that sought to get rid of the influence of witchcraft from the Salem population. The vast
majority of people who were accused of being witches were mostly women. These accusations had
more to do with the social status of these women rather than to seek to understand them. The first
hanging began with the death of Bridget Bishop in June and continued until September. The Salem
witchcraft trials included an example of scapegoating because Puritans feared that the devil was
continuously looking for ways to test their faith.

Symptom 7: Shortness of Breath
Trouble catching your breath can be related to the kidneys in two ways. First, extra fluid in the body
can build up in the lungs. And second, anemia (a shortage of oxygen carrying red blood cells) can
leave your body oxygen starved and short of breath.

What is Tuberculosis? Tuberculosis, TB for short, is an ancient disease that has been around even
before the first recorded disease in the history. This disease can be found in Egyptian mummies from
4000 BC. Tuberculosis is caused by Mycobacterium tuberculosis, or tubercle bacillus ( Centers for
disease, 2011). Tuberculosis is primarily a disease of the lungs, but the TB bacterium can also travel
through blood stream and attack any part of the body like kidney, spine and brain (Hamann, 1994).
According to CDC, tuberculosis is considered one of the world s deadliest diseases; 1/3 of the world s
population suffers from TB infection, in 2010, there were nearly nine million people that became sick
with TB around the world, and TB is the 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
Although some of the some scientist back in 1719, Benjamin Martin wrote a book called A New
Theory of Consumption, More Especially of Phthisis or Consumption of the Lungs, in this book he
noted the likelihood of the tuberculosis contagion stating that close proximity to someone that has this
disease causes the other person to acquired it (Reichman Hershfield, 2000). Which in a way, Benjamin
Martin, is right on point. Tuberculosis is an airborne disease, which means its main mode of
transmission is through the air. Animals such as cattle can carrier the bacteria, but most cause human
is the main reservoir of this disease (Hamann, 1994). When an infected person that has active
tuberculosis will be able to infect the air around him/her by sneezing, coughing, speaking or even
singing ( Centers for disease, 2011). The airborne droplet of the bacteria lingers longer in the air and
thus people that are in close proximity or just happen to walk by and breathe in the bacteria will
become infected. Unlike any other contagious disease, TB is not spread by shaking someone s hand,
sharing food or drink, touching bed lines or toilet seat, sharing personal items and kissing. But not
everyone that s been exposed to someone that has tuberculosis becomes symptomatic, or sick; as a
result there is two types of Tuberculosis related conditions; latent TB infection and active TB
... Get more on HelpWriting.net ...
